How to Make the Perfect Fresh and Creamy Hummus
Ingredients
- 1 can (15 oz) chickpeas: The star ingredient, providing a creamy base and protein. You can also use dried chickpeas; just soak and cook them beforehand.
- 1/4 cup tahini: This sesame paste adds a rich, nutty flavor. If you don’t have tahini, you can substitute with sunflower seed butter for a similar taste.
- 2 tablespoons olive oil: Enhances creaminess and adds healthy fats. Feel free to use avocado oil for a different flavor profile.
- 2 tablespoons lemon juice: Freshly squeezed is best for brightness. Lime juice can be a zesty alternative.
- 1 garlic clove, minced: Adds a punch of flavor. If you prefer a milder taste, use roasted garlic instead.
- 1/2 teaspoon ground cumin: This spice brings warmth and depth. You can omit it if you want a more straightforward flavor.
- Salt to taste: Essential for enhancing all the flavors. Start with a pinch and adjust as needed.
- Water as needed: To achieve your desired consistency. You can also use aquafaba (the liquid from the chickpeas) for added flavor.
Step-by-Step Instructions
- In a food processor, combine the drained and rinsed chickpeas, tahini, olive oil, lemon juice, minced garlic, ground cumin, and salt.
- Blend the mixture until smooth. If it’s too thick, gradually add water, one tablespoon at a time, until you reach your desired consistency.
- Taste your hummus and adjust the seasoning if necessary. A little extra lemon juice or salt can elevate the flavor!
- Transfer the hummus to a serving bowl. Drizzle with olive oil and, if desired, sprinkle with paprika or fresh herbs for a pop of color.

Top Tips from Well-Known Chefs
Creating the perfect Fresh and Creamy Hummus can be an art, and I’ve gathered some invaluable tips from renowned chefs to elevate your dip to the next level. Here are their top hacks:
- Use Ice Water: Chef Yotam Ottolenghi suggests adding ice water while blending to achieve an ultra-smooth texture. It helps to emulsify the ingredients better.
- Peel the Chickpeas: For an even creamier hummus, Chef Michael Solomonov recommends peeling the chickpeas. It’s a bit time-consuming but worth the effort for that silky finish.
- Experiment with Flavors: Chef Einat Admony encourages you to get creative! Try adding roasted red peppers, sun-dried tomatoes, or even spices like smoked paprika for a unique twist.
- Fresh Ingredients Matter: Chef Alice Waters emphasizes the importance of using fresh, high-quality ingredients. Fresh lemon juice and good olive oil can make a significant difference in flavor.
- Let It Rest: Chef Hummus Bar’s owner, Oren Sidi, suggests letting your hummus sit for at least 30 minutes before serving. This allows the flavors to meld beautifully.

Storing and Reheating Tips
To keep your Fresh and Creamy Hummus tasting its best, follow these simple storage and reheating tips:
- Refrigeration: Store hummus in an airtight container in the fridge. It will stay fresh for up to a week.
- Freezing: For longer storage, freeze hummus in a freezer-safe container. It can last up to 3 months. Just leave some space at the top for expansion.
- Thawing: When ready to use frozen hummus, transfer it to the fridge to thaw overnight. For a quicker option, you can thaw it at room temperature for a few hours.
- Reheating: If you prefer warm hummus, gently heat it in the microwave in 15-second intervals, stirring in between until warmed through.
- Reviving Texture: If your hummus thickens after refrigeration, simply stir in a little water or olive oil to restore its creamy consistency.
Common Mistakes to Avoid
- Not Draining Chickpeas Properly: Failing to drain and rinse your chickpeas can lead to a watery hummus. Always rinse to remove excess sodium and improve flavor.
- Skipping the Tahini: Some may think they can skip tahini for a lighter dip, but it’s essential for that creamy texture and nutty flavor. Don’t omit it!
- Over-Processing: Blending for too long can make your hummus gummy. Blend just until smooth, adding water gradually to achieve the right consistency.
- Ignoring Seasoning: Hummus can taste bland without proper seasoning. Always taste and adjust salt and lemon juice to enhance the flavors.
- Serving Immediately: While it’s tempting to dig in right away, letting your hummus rest for at least 30 minutes allows the flavors to meld beautifully.

Fresh and Creamy Hummus: Easy Recipe for a Delicious, Homemade Dip
- Total Time: 10 minutes
- Yield: 2 cups 1x
- Diet: Vegan
Description
A simple and delicious recipe for making fresh and creamy hummus at home.
Ingredients
- 1 can (15 oz) chickpeas, drained and rinsed
- 1/4 cup tahini
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- 2 tablespoons lemon juice
- 1 garlic clove, minced
- 1/2 teaspoon ground cumin
- Salt to taste
- Water as needed for consistency
Instructions
- In a food processor, combine the chickpeas, tahini, olive oil, lemon juice, garlic, cumin, and salt.
- Blend until smooth, adding water as needed to achieve desired consistency.
- Taste and adjust seasoning if necessary.
- Transfer to a serving bowl and drizzle with olive oil before serving.
Notes
- For a smoother texture, peel the chickpeas before blending.
- Serve with pita bread or fresh vegetables.
- Store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to a week.
